Output 3439382fac115020e221bb2b4e94f1d1e7ecfaddc277efa8879c7e443e495aba:0

value
34963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a6479357fe354b4680ba3912b1fb108225749ae OP_EQUAL
address
38UNHkwjSKSpvKUehNCCumtEYbuU8PK9Xd
transaction
3439382fac115020e221bb2b4e94f1d1e7ecfaddc277efa8879c7e443e495aba